Commander, previously (and still in some circles) known as Elder Dragon Highlander, is a popular MTG format in which players use carefully-designed, 100-card singleton decks, headed up by a powerful Commander
This The Lord of the Rings: Tales of Middle-earth Commander Deck set includes 1 ready-to-play deck of 100 Magic cards (2 Traditional Foil Legendary Creature cards, 98 nonfoil cards), a 2-card Collector Booster Sample Pack (contains 1 Traditional Foil or nonfoil special treatment card of rarity Rare or higher and 1 Traditional Foil special treatment Common or Uncommon card), 1 foil-etched Display Commander (a thick cardstock copy of the commander card with foil etched into the cards border and art), 10 double-sided tokens, 1 Helper card, 1 deck box (can hold 100 sleeved cards), 1 Life Wheel, 1 strategy insert, and 1 reference card
